The global hot water storage tank market is set to expand steadily from 2026 through 2033, with the market projected to reach about USD 8.9 billion by 2033 at a CAGR of 5.6%. Demand is being shaped by residential replacement cycles, commercial building upgrades, industrial process heating needs, and tighter energy-efficiency standards that are pushing buyers toward better insulated and smarter storage systems. These tanks sit at the center of water heating systems by storing heated water for later use, reducing peak-load stress on heaters and improving user comfort in homes, hotels, hospitals, factories, and public facilities. The market is also benefiting from electrification trends, hybrid heating adoption, and stronger interest in solar and heat pump compatible storage designs.
From 2019 to 2025, the market moved through a period of uneven but constructive growth, rising from roughly USD 5.8 billion in 2019 to about USD 7.0 billion in 2025, with the pandemic years creating short interruptions in construction activity and project scheduling. By 2026, the market is estimated at around USD 7.4 billion, reflecting resumed building investment, replacement demand in mature housing stock, and stronger commercial refurbishment activity. Growth has not been purely volume driven; average selling prices improved as thicker insulation, enamel lining, corrosion resistance, and digital temperature control became more common across mid and premium tiers. According to a synthesis of industry shipment patterns and installed base behavior that aligns with Stats N Data style market modeling, the forecast implies an addition of nearly USD 1.5 billion in new value between 2026 and 2033, with Asia Pacific contributing the largest absolute gain and Europe remaining a major upgrade market.
In the United States, demand is anchored by a large installed base of water heating systems and a strong replacement cycle in single-family housing, multifamily properties, hospitality, and healthcare facilities. The market is expected to grow from about USD 1.1 billion in 2026 to roughly USD 1.4 billion by 2033, supported by energy code tightening, heat pump water heater adoption, and ongoing suburban housing turnover. Commercial users continue to favor higher-capacity tanks for reliability and peak management, while builders are increasingly specifying tanks that integrate more easily with electric and solar-assisted systems. Investment is also visible in warehouse, school, and municipal retrofit programs, where lifecycle cost matters more than initial price.
China remains the largest production and consumption center in the market, with demand supported by urban housing, hospitality expansion, industrial water systems, and broad manufacturing strength. The market is projected to rise from around USD 1.5 billion in 2026 to nearly USD 2.0 billion by 2033, with growth tied to residential upgrades in tier 1 and tier 2 cities and large-scale commercial construction in fast-growing provinces. Local manufacturers benefit from dense supply chains for steel, insulation materials, and valves, keeping domestic pricing competitive and export capacity high. The country’s shift toward higher-efficiency buildings and cleaner electric heating systems is also making well-insulated tanks more relevant in both new builds and retrofits.
Germany offers a more policy-led demand profile, where energy efficiency, decarbonization, and building modernization are central buying factors. The market is expected to move from about USD 320 million in 2026 to around USD 400 million by 2033, helped by replacement demand in older housing stock and strong integration with heat pump systems. German buyers tend to favor premium, long-life tanks with precise thermal control, corrosion protection, and compatibility with district heating or solar thermal systems. Investment is concentrated in residential renovation, commercial energy retrofits, and industrial process applications, making Germany an important value market rather than a pure volume market.
Japan’s market is shaped by high urban density, aging housing stock, and a preference for compact, efficient systems that fit limited installation space. The market should grow from roughly USD 260 million in 2026 to about USD 320 million by 2033, with demand supported by apartment replacements, commercial lodging upgrades, and water heating systems designed for reliability and low standby loss. Japanese buyers place strong value on durability, safety, and precision control, which supports premium models with advanced insulation and smart monitoring. The country’s aging population also supports steady refurbishment in hospitals, elder care facilities, and institutional buildings, where dependable hot water availability is essential.
India is one of the fastest-growing demand centers, moving from about USD 420 million in 2026 to roughly USD 700 million by 2033 as urban construction, hotel development, and industrial expansion broaden the addressable market. Residential demand is increasing as higher-income households and large housing projects adopt storage-based solutions for more consistent hot water supply, especially in colder northern regions and premium urban housing. Commercial demand is also rising in healthcare, education, and hospitality, where larger tanks help manage peak usage and reduce operating disruptions. Local manufacturing is expanding, but price sensitivity remains high, so growth is strongest in mid-range tanks that balance efficiency with affordability.
South Korea’s market is comparatively smaller but technically advanced, with demand supported by apartment complexes, office buildings, and high-spec residential systems. The market is projected to rise from around USD 190 million in 2026 to about USD 235 million by 2033, driven by efficient building standards and the replacement of older equipment in dense urban housing. Consumers and building operators favor compact units with high insulation performance, fast recovery, and integration with smart home controls. Industrial users also contribute through food processing, electronics facilities, and commercial laundry applications, where stable hot water supply affects both output quality and operating cost.
Italy has a strong base of residential and hospitality demand, with a market expected to grow from about USD 250 million in 2026 to nearly USD 310 million by 2033. The country’s housing stock is older than much of Western Europe’s, which supports replacement demand for better insulated and more efficient tanks in apartments, villas, and mixed-use properties. Tourism remains an important consumption driver, especially in hotels, resorts, and heritage properties that need reliable but space-conscious systems. Investments are also linked to building renovation incentives, and buyers often look for compatibility with solar thermal and heat pump installations, which keeps the market tilted toward higher-spec products.
France shows steady expansion from roughly USD 290 million in 2026 to about USD 360 million by 2033, supported by residential refurbishment, hotel modernization, and public building upgrades. Demand is shaped by energy performance rules that make standby loss and integration efficiency more important in purchasing decisions. A significant share of sales comes from replacement in apartment buildings and small commercial facilities, where system reliability and ease of maintenance matter as much as purchase price. Utility-linked efficiency programs and contractor-led specification decisions continue to influence product selection, creating an environment where quality and compliance carry clear commercial weight.
The United Kingdom market is expected to increase from about USD 230 million in 2026 to around USD 285 million by 2033, with the strongest demand coming from replacement in homes, care facilities, and hospitality properties. Energy bills remain a key concern, so buyers are paying more attention to insulation quality, heat retention, and compatibility with low-carbon heating systems. Renovation activity in older housing and public-sector buildings is supporting sales of storage tanks that can work alongside heat pumps and indirect systems. Distribution is highly contractor influenced, which means brands that can secure specification with installers and heating engineers tend to perform better than those relying only on consumer awareness.
Canada’s market is driven by cold climate demand, long heating seasons, and a wide stock of detached homes and low-rise commercial buildings. The market is projected to grow from about USD 180 million in 2026 to near USD 225 million by 2033, with replacement demand stronger than greenfield construction in many provinces. Buyers value freeze resilience, insulation performance, and dependable operation during extended winter periods, especially in residential and hospitality settings. Public buildings, remote communities, and institutional facilities also support demand for larger storage systems, while electrification policies are slowly increasing interest in heat pump compatible tanks.
Mexico is benefiting from industrial growth, housing construction, and commercial development tied to manufacturing corridors and urban expansion. The market should expand from about USD 160 million in 2026 to around USD 240 million by 2033, with strong momentum in hotels, multifamily housing, food service, and industrial process applications. Proximity to North American supply chains is supporting investment in mid-sized production and distribution networks, while affordability remains central to consumer choice. Demand is especially healthy in regions with expanding tourism and in industrial zones where reliable hot water supports sanitation, maintenance, and processing needs.
Brazil’s market is expected to rise from roughly USD 240 million in 2026 to about USD 330 million by 2033, supported by urban housing growth, hospitality demand, and industrial use in food, beverage, and manufacturing. The market is uneven across regions, with stronger adoption in wealthier urban centers and cooler southern areas where storage systems are more common and more necessary. Buyers are highly price conscious, but demand for better insulated and corrosion-resistant tanks is increasing as service expectations rise. Utility and infrastructure constraints can weigh on adoption, yet the scale of the residential and commercial base still creates meaningful room for expansion.
Turkey combines residential need, commercial tourism demand, and a sizable industrial base that uses hot water storage across manufacturing and service sectors. The market is forecast to move from about USD 140 million in 2026 to around USD 190 million by 2033, helped by building activity, replacement demand, and broader investment in energy efficiency. Hotels, hospitals, and multi-family buildings are major consumers, while industrial users value tanks that can handle variable demand and maintain temperature stability. Domestic manufacturing is important, but inflation and import cost swings can affect pricing and project timing, making execution discipline critical.
Indonesia presents a faster-growing Southeast Asian market, expanding from about USD 120 million in 2026 to roughly USD 190 million by 2033 as urbanization, tourism, and middle-class spending widen demand. Hotels, apartment towers, hospitals, and upscale residential developments are the main buyers, while industrial usage is gradually expanding in food processing and cleaning-intensive operations. Tropical conditions do not eliminate the need for storage tanks, especially where centralized hot water systems are used for commercial comfort and sanitation. Investment in resort destinations and large cities is supporting product penetration, particularly for cost-effective stainless and glass-lined models.
Vietnam is moving from a smaller base, but the market is expected to grow from around USD 95 million in 2026 to about USD 155 million by 2033. Growth is driven by hotel construction, industrial parks, urban housing, and the gradual rise of higher-service residential and commercial buildings. Local and regional suppliers are competing on price and installation convenience, while international brands are gaining traction in higher-spec projects. Demand is strongest in large cities and export-oriented industrial zones, where sanitation and process reliability support the case for larger or better insulated storage systems.
Saudi Arabia has one of the clearest demand stories in the region because of large-scale commercial construction, hospitality investment, healthcare expansion, and climate-driven hot water usage patterns. The market is projected to grow from about USD 170 million in 2026 to around USD 250 million by 2033, with tourism and infrastructure programs supporting heavy project pipelines. Buyers often prioritize large-capacity, corrosion-resistant tanks that can work efficiently in high-temperature environments and with centralized systems. The scale of new urban development gives suppliers opportunities in both luxury and mid-market projects, while energy efficiency is becoming more important as operating costs receive greater attention.
The United Arab Emirates follows a similar pattern, with demand supported by hotels, residential towers, healthcare, and mixed-use developments across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and the wider emirates. The market is expected to rise from roughly USD 110 million in 2026 to about USD 160 million by 2033, driven by high service expectations and continual investment in premium real estate. Storage tanks here are often specified for reliability, fast recovery, and compatibility with centralized mechanical systems in tall buildings and large facilities. Procurement is highly project-based, so suppliers that can support engineering teams and contractors tend to secure stronger positions than those focused only on commodity sales.
South Africa’s market remains shaped by infrastructure quality, load management concerns, and the need for dependable hot water in homes, hotels, mines, and public facilities. The market should grow from about USD 105 million in 2026 to around USD 145 million by 2033, helped by replacement demand and gradual investment in commercial buildings and institutional capacity. Buyers are sensitive to running cost and durability because maintenance conditions vary widely across regions. Power reliability issues also make storage and heat retention important, which supports demand for better insulated products and systems that reduce dependence on continuous heating.
Australia’s market is projected to rise from roughly USD 185 million in 2026 to about USD 235 million by 2033, supported by residential replacement, commercial upgrades, and a strong emphasis on energy-efficient heating. The country has a high share of detached housing and a growing interest in heat pump and solar-compatible storage systems, which improves the value proposition for modern tanks. Demand is also supported by resorts, healthcare, and educational facilities that need dependable hot water with lower operating cost. Regulatory pressure around efficiency and the replacement of aging systems continues to nudge the market toward premium product categories.
Thailand is benefiting from tourism, urban housing, and industrial activity, with the market expected to grow from about USD 130 million in 2026 to roughly USD 185 million by 2033. Hotels, serviced apartments, hospitals, and food-related industries are the core users, while residential demand is expanding in urban centers and upper-income segments. The market remains price sensitive, yet contractors are increasingly specifying better insulated products when long-term operating cost is visible. Investment in tourism infrastructure and manufacturing zones is likely to keep demand moving at a healthy pace through the forecast period.
Spain’s market is forecast to increase from about USD 210 million in 2026 to nearly USD 265 million by 2033, supported by residential renovation, tourism, and commercial modernization. The country has a large hospitality footprint, which creates recurring demand for reliable storage systems with efficient recovery and temperature stability. Energy efficiency rules and retrofit activity are pushing both homeowners and property managers toward upgraded tanks and system integration. The market also benefits from solar thermal familiarity, which keeps demand open for indirect and hybrid-compatible products.
The Netherlands market is smaller in absolute size but strong in technical quality and energy-conscious purchasing. It is expected to grow from about USD 95 million in 2026 to around USD 120 million by 2033, supported by renovation, district heating integration, and commercial building upgrades. Buyers tend to prioritize compact design, low heat loss, and compatibility with efficient heating systems rather than simple capacity. This makes the market attractive for premium suppliers that can prove performance and support digital monitoring or smart integration.
Poland’s market is moving from about USD 125 million in 2026 to around USD 175 million by 2033, with demand supported by new housing, commercial development, and industrial upgrading. Residential growth remains important, but industrial and public building demand is also building as energy efficiency standards improve. The country continues to attract manufacturing and logistics investment, which raises demand for water heating in warehouses, plants, and worker facilities. Price competition is intense, yet buyers are increasingly receptive to better insulated tanks that reduce operating expense over time.
Malaysia is expected to expand from roughly USD 115 million in 2026 to about USD 165 million by 2033, with urban housing, hospitality, and commercial real estate leading demand. The climate reduces some residential need, but centralized systems in hotels, hospitals, malls, and premium apartment blocks keep the market relevant. Industrial use in food, electronics support, and cleaning operations also contributes to steady consumption. Investment remains strongest in major urban corridors, where specification quality and service support can justify a higher price point.
Argentina remains a more volatile market, but it still offers selective opportunity in urban housing, hospitality, and commercial replacement demand. The market is projected to grow from about USD 70 million in 2026 to roughly USD 95 million by 2033, though purchasing patterns can be affected by inflation, import constraints, and project financing conditions. Demand is concentrated in Buenos Aires and other major cities, where the service economy and residential replacement cycles are strongest. Suppliers that can manage pricing flexibility and local availability are better placed than those relying on long imported lead times.
Across segmentation, storage tanks are generally split between electric, gas, solar-assisted, and indirect or boiler-linked types, with electric units holding the broadest household reach and indirect systems leading in commercial and larger building applications. By application, residential use remains the largest share at roughly 48% of global demand in 2026, followed by commercial at about 32% and industrial at around 20%, with the commercial share rising faster in tourism and institutional markets. Regionally, Asia Pacific accounts for close to 43% of global revenue, Europe about 26%, North America around 19%, and the rest spread across Latin America, the Middle East, and Africa. In practical terms, product choice is being shaped less by raw tank capacity and more by insulation quality, recovery speed, corrosion resistance, and compatibility with low-carbon heating systems.
The strongest market driver is the need for reliable hot water in expanding residential and commercial building stocks, especially where storage improves service continuity and energy use management. Another important force is the shift toward electrified heating and heat pump systems, which often depend on storage to reduce cycling and improve system efficiency. Urbanization, hotel construction, healthcare expansion, and renovation of aging buildings are also lifting replacement demand in both mature and emerging economies. In a market model consistent with what Stats N Data typically tracks, nearly two-thirds of 2026 to 2033 growth comes from replacement and upgrade demand rather than first-time installation alone.
Restraints remain real and they are often tied to upfront cost, space requirements, and competing technologies such as tankless water heaters in certain residential settings. Volatile steel prices and freight costs can pressure margins, while building owners in lower-income markets may defer replacement until failure forces action. Another limitation is that some buyers see hot water storage tanks as a simple commodity, which makes pricing highly competitive and limits brand loyalty in value tiers. In regions with weak infrastructure or unstable power supply, maintenance issues and inconsistent service support can also slow adoption, especially for larger or more complex systems.
Opportunities are strongest where storage tanks can be paired with energy transition projects, solar thermal installations, and heat pump deployments. There is also room to grow in modular commercial systems for hotels, hospitals, and schools, where savings from better insulation and smarter controls are increasingly easy to quantify. Industrial users offer another path, particularly in food processing, laundries, and light manufacturing, where process stability matters as much as cost. The most interesting opening is probably in mid-premium products that blend efficiency, durability, and digital monitoring at a price point acceptable to contractors and property managers.
The main challenges are cost pressure, specification complexity, and the need to serve very different customer profiles across residential, commercial, and industrial channels. Suppliers must balance standardized manufacturing with local code requirements, different water quality conditions, and varied installation practices. Service capability matters more than many buyers admit, because poor installation can erase product advantages and increase warranty claims. Shortening project cycles, meeting efficiency standards, and avoiding inventory mismatches are all becoming harder as buyers expect both speed and customization.
Technology trends are clearly moving toward better insulation, corrosion-resistant linings, smart thermostatic controls, and hybrid-ready storage designs. More manufacturers are adding digital sensors that track temperature, energy use, and fault conditions, which is especially useful in commercial and institutional systems. Heat pump compatibility is becoming a major design priority in Europe, North America, and parts of Asia, while solar thermal integration remains important in sun-rich markets. Product development is also focusing on lighter tank structures, easier installation, and longer service life, because these features reduce total cost of ownership and support contractor preference.
Competitive conditions are fragmented, with global brands, regional manufacturers, and local fabricators competing across price tiers and application niches. The market rewards companies that can combine manufacturing scale with reliable distribution, installation support, and code compliance, rather than simply offering the lowest price. Players with strong positions in commercial equipment often hold better margins because specification-based selling is less vulnerable to pure commodity competition. Stats N Data analysis suggests that brands with a clear premium positioning and a contractor-first channel model are likely to keep gaining share even in markets where volume growth is moderate.
